Websites using nameserver telc.eu

1 websites

The nameserver telc.eu have a IP Address of 185.178.174.119 which is hosted on Czech Republic.

1.Telc.eu

telc.eu Rank:1,970,152 Worth:$160

Telc | https://www.telc.eu/

Let's share 💋💋💋